• 전문가 요청 쿠폰 이벤트
*상*
Bronze개인
팔로워0 팔로우
소개
등록된 소개글이 없습니다.
전문분야 등록된 전문분야가 없습니다.
판매자 정보
학교정보
입력된 정보가 없습니다.
직장정보
입력된 정보가 없습니다.
자격증
  • 입력된 정보가 없습니다.
판매지수
전체자료 4
검색어 입력폼
  • 버퍼를 가지는 큐구현
    #include "vxWorks.h"#include "stdio.h"#include "strLib.h"#include "logLib.h"#define MAXSIZE 300/****************************//*Typedefine BUFFER struct. *//****************************/typedef struct buf{char buffer[1316];}Buf;/***************************//*Typedefine QUEUE struct. *//***************************/typedef struct Queue{int length;int front, rear;Buf msgbuf[MAXSIZE];}QUEUE;/****************************//***** Initialize QUEUE *****//****************************/int init_queue(QUEUE *q)
    프로그램소스| 2006.10.23| 1,000원| 조회(345)
    미리보기
  • 이중연결리스트
    typedef struct _node{char *key;int length;struct _node * prev;struct _node * next; }node;node * head, *tail;void init_queue(void){head = (node*)malloc(sizeof(node));tail = (node*)malloc(sizeof(node));head->prev = head;head->next = tail;tail->prev = head;tail->prev = tail;}void clear_queue(void){node *t;node *s; t= head->next;while(t != tail){s = t;t = t->next;free(s);}head->next = tail;tail->prev = head;}int put(char *k,int n){node *t;if((t=(node *)malloc(sizeof(node))) == NULL){printf("n out of memory.");return 0;}
    프로그램소스| 2006.10.12| 1,000원| 조회(416)
    미리보기
  • 동영상 재전송 서버
    #include "sockLib.h"#include "inetLib.h"#include "stdioLib.h"#include "strLib.h"#include "ioLib.h"#include "fioLib.h"#include "linked.h"int socklen;struct sockaddr_in clientAddr;char inetAddr[INET_ADDR_LEN];STATUS server(void){WSADATA wsaData;struct sockaddr_in serverAddr;int sFd, cFd,tid;if(WSAStartup(MAKEWORD(2,2),&wsaData) != 0)perror("WSAStartup() error!");printf("소켓생성중n");socklen = sizeof (struct sockaddr_in);if ((sFd = socket (AF_INET, SOCK_DGRAM, 0)) == ERROR){perror ("socket");return (ERROR);}bzero ((char *) &serverAddr, socklen);serverAddr.sin_len = (u_char) socklen;serverAddr.sin_family = AF_INET;serverAddr.sin_port = htons (포트번호를 입력);serverAddr.sin_addr.s_addr = inet_addr ("서버주소를 입력해주세요,아니면(inaddr_any로사용");if (bind (sFd, (struct sockaddr *) &serverAddr, socklen) == ERROR){perror ("bind");close (sFd);return (ERROR);}echo(sFd);}void echo(int s){char msg[5120]; //동영상이 담길 버퍼void *msg2,*msg3;int i=0, j = 0;node *t=t;init_queue();clear_queue();while(1){int rcvLen = 0;rcvLen = recvfrom(s, msg, sizeof(msg), 0, (struct sockaddr *)&clientAddr, &socklen);msg3 = &msg; //동영상의 첫번째주소를 포인터변수 msg3에 삽입if(rcvLen > 0){put(msg3,rcvLen); //헤더의 풋함수호출..주소값과 길이입력}inet_ntoa_b (clientAddr.sin_addr, inetAddr);printf ("CLIENT Address (%s), port (%d):n",inetAddr, ntohs (clientAddr.sin_port));// 클라이언트의 ip와 포트번호 출력if(strcmp(msg,"q")==0){printf("client closed.n");close(s);break;}msg2 = get();if(msg2!=NULL){clientAddr.sin_port = htons (5003); ////받는쪽의 포트가 다르다면 여기서 설정sendto(s, msg2, rcvLen, 0, (struct sockaddr *)&clientAddr, socklen);}clear_queue();}}
    프로그램소스| 2006.10.12| 1,000원| 조회(300)
    미리보기
  • vxworks기반 에코서버
    #include "stdioLib.h" #include "strLib.h" #include "ioLib.h" #include "fioLib.h" #include "haha.h" /*<----타겟서버의 포트넘버 정의,INET_ADDR_LEN 크기 정의*/STATUS server (void) { struct sockaddr_in serverAddr; struct sockaddr_in clientAddr; int socklen; /* size of socket address structure */ int sFd; /* socket file descriptor */ char msg[INET_ADDR_LEN]; printf("Make a socketn");socklen = sizeof (struct sockaddr_in); bzero ((char *) &serverAddr, socklen); serverAddr.sin_len = (u_char) socklen; serverAddr.sin_family = AF_INET; serverAddr.sin_port = htons (SERVER_PORT_NUM); serverAddr.sin_addr.s_addr = inet_addr ("SERVER ADDR"); /* <----여기에 타겟서버의 주소를...*/if ((sFd = socket (AF_INET, SOCK_DGRAM, 0)) == ERROR) { perror ("socket"); return (ERROR); } printf("bind a socketn"); if (bind (sFd, (struct sockaddr *) &serverAddr, socklen) == ERROR)
    프로그램소스| 2006.09.21| 1,000원| 조회(528)
    미리보기
전체보기
해캠 AI 챗봇과 대화하기
챗봇으로 간편하게 상담해보세요.
2026년 04월 17일 금요일
AI 챗봇
안녕하세요. 해피캠퍼스 AI 챗봇입니다. 무엇이 궁금하신가요?
12:56 오후
문서 초안을 생성해주는 EasyAI
안녕하세요 해피캠퍼스의 20년의 운영 노하우를 이용하여 당신만의 초안을 만들어주는 EasyAI 입니다.
저는 아래와 같이 작업을 도와드립니다.
- 주제만 입력하면 AI가 방대한 정보를 재가공하여, 최적의 목차와 내용을 자동으로 만들어 드립니다.
- 장문의 콘텐츠를 쉽고 빠르게 작성해 드립니다.
- 스토어에서 무료 이용권를 계정별로 1회 발급 받을 수 있습니다. 지금 바로 체험해 보세요!
이런 주제들을 입력해 보세요.
- 유아에게 적합한 문학작품의 기준과 특성
- 한국인의 가치관 중에서 정신적 가치관을 이루는 것들을 문화적 문법으로 정리하고, 현대한국사회에서 일어나는 사건과 사고를 비교하여 자신의 의견으로 기술하세요
- 작별인사 독후감